The PPA is a Ubuntu repository usable on Debian, no need to compile anymore just add the repo and install.
If you are based on Raspian Jessie, check the "Deluge Launchpad PPA section" of http://dev.deluge-torrent.org/wiki/Inst ... ian/Jessie
For Raspian Stretch the wiki is not updated yet but you can rely on the steps of my post http://forum.deluge-torrent.org/viewtop ... =7&t=54783
